We are looking for Cost and Value Engineering Specialist – Mechanical
You’ll make a difference by
As a Cost and Value Engineering (CVE) Professional, you will drive initiatives to maximize product value while minimizing costs in a competitive, cost-sensitive environment. Your role involves identifying improvement opportunities, leading process optimization, and ensuring transparency throughout the product life cycle. By leveraging Bottom-up Cost Value Engineering methodologies, you will set cost optimization targets, assess alternative technical solutions, and deliver the most cost-effective outcomes—focusing primarily on mechanical components and technologies.
- Apply the CVE methodology toolkit to identify, evaluate, and realize cost and optimization potentials in collaboration with cross-functional teams.
- Analyze processes and develop solutions for process and technology optimization at suppliers along the value chain.
- Conduct concept evaluations and development-related cost calculations.
- Contribute to CVE strategic topics within the Mobility division and further develop the CVE approach in close cooperation with Procurement, Engineering, and Supplier Quality Management.
- Actively participate in knowledge exchange within the Siemens-wide CVE expert network.
